On Gandhi Jayanti, the Viyyur central jail in Thrissur district in Kerala held a book fair that witnessed inmates purchasing books worth Rs 1.10 lakh. It was the first such book fair held in the prison.

Kerala Sahitya Akademi president Vaisakhan inaugurated the event. The book fair was open from 10 am to 2 in the afternoon. Writer Asokan Charuvil and poet Ravunni, who were also present at the book fair, interacted and spent time with the prisoners.

People from outside were also welcome at the prison book fair. In the span of four hours, books worth over Rs 1 lakh were purchased by prisoners and outsiders alike. Some even donated books to the prison library.

According to prison rules, there are restrictions on inmates for spending money, but they were relaxed for the event. The inmates also made illustrations and other decorations that were in display at the event. Apart from the book fair, there was also an exhibition sale of the artwork and handicraft items made by the prisoners.
